Abstract :
Hydrophobic property of concrete with different mixture was studied before and after coating two types of silane products. Adsorption mass of water and NaCl solution of concrete surface were adopted to determine the hydrophobic property. The results show that the water adsorption ability of concrete without silane coating decreases with the higher strength and more air content of concrete. The NaCl solution adsorbed by concrete during 6 hours is 20 to 30% higher than the water. The coating of either cream or liquid phase of silane markedly improves the hydrophobic property of concrete surface and reduces the water adsorption mass of concrete during 6 hours by 90%. For concrete with a lower strength and less air content, the coating of silane shows a better improved hydrophobic property of concrete. The coating of either cream or liquid phase of silane reduces the NaCl solution adsorption a little more than the water adsorption for every concrete.
